BakaXL-Launcher / BakaXL

BakaXL 项目门户 / BakaXL Project's Portal
https://www.BakaXL.com
286 stars 57 forks source link

[Bug]启动器出现崩溃 #649

Open cloudw233 opened 7 months ago

cloudw233 commented 7 months ago

检查项

遇到的问题

打开BakaXL,然后它崩了,严重影响正常使用

期望的结果

正常使用

如何重现此问题?

打开bakaxl,崩溃

可能造成问题的原因

可能是奇怪的系统设置?

系统环境

版本 Windows 11 专业版 版本号 24H2 安装日期 ‎2024/‎2/‎25 操作系统版本 26063.1 体验 Windows Feature Experience Pack 1000.26063.1.0

启动器版本

BakaXL Insider Preview 3.5.0.0 鹦鹉通道 Build.2024.02,24.1947

附注

笨蛋罐头

{
  "BakaVersion": "Insider-Parrot-3.5",
  "ErrorTitle": "一个未经处理的BakaXL异常(非窗体线程)",
  "ExceptionCanInfo": {
    "ErrorCode": "BUE-002",
    "ErrorTime": "03/01/2024 22:52:58"
  },
  "ExceptionInfo": {
    "Message": "值不能为 null。\r\n参数名: key",
    "InnerException": "-",
    "StackTrace": "   在 System.ThrowHelper.ThrowArgumentNullException(ExceptionArgument argument)\r\n   在 System.Collections.Generic.Dictionary`2.FindEntry(TKey key)\r\n   在 BakaXL.ViewModel.Pages.CoreManagement.PageCoreModsModel.<>c__DisplayClass37_1.<CheckModDependencysAsync>b__2()\r\n   在 System.Threading.Tasks.Task.Execute()\r\n--- 引发异常的上一位置中堆栈跟踪的末尾 ---\r\n   在 System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()\r\n   在 BakaXL.ViewModel.Pages.CoreManagement.PageCoreModsModel.<CheckModDependencysAsync>d__37.MoveNext()\r\n--- 引发异常的上一位置中堆栈跟踪的末尾 ---\r\n   在 System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()\r\n   在 System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)\r\n   在 System.Runtime.CompilerServices.TaskAwaiter.GetResult()\r\n   在 BakaXL.GameCores.Management.ModManager.<UpdateOnlineInfo>d__17.MoveNext()\r\n--- 引发异常的上一位置中堆栈跟踪的末尾 ---\r\n   在 System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()\r\n   在 BakaXL.GameCores.Management.ModManager.<InitViewModel>d__11.MoveNext()\r\n--- 引发异常的上一位置中堆栈跟踪的末尾 ---\r\n   在 System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()\r\n   在 BakaXL.GameCores.Management.ModManager.<Load>d__9.MoveNext()\r\n--- 引发异常的上一位置中堆栈跟踪的末尾 ---\r\n   在 System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()\r\n   在 System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)\r\n   在 System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)\r\n   在 System.Threading.QueueUserWorkItemCallback.System.Threading.IThreadPoolWorkItem.ExecuteWorkItem()\r\n   在 System.Threading.ThreadPoolWorkQueue.Dispatch()",
    "Solution": "请立即将此错误上报BakaXL开发团队以便尽快修复。"
  },
  "NetworkInfo": {
    "NetworkStatus": true,
    "PCNetworkInterface": "Wireless",
    "InterfaceName": "WLAN",
    "InterfaceDescription": "Intel(R) Wi-Fi 6 AX201 160MHz",
    "Wireless": "-",
    "ProxyStatus": false
  },
  "SoftwareInfo": {
    "SoftwareTitle": "BakaXL.Pages.PageHome",
    "Version": "-",
    "SoftwareLocation": "CurrentDomain_UnhandledException"
  },
  "EnvironmentInfo": {
    "Language": "中文(中国) / 中文(简体,中国) / Chinese (Simplified, Mainland China)",
    "TimeZone": "(UTC+08:00) 北京,重庆,香港特别行政区,乌鲁木齐",
    "Region": "中国 / 中华人民共和国 / China"
  },
  "MinecraftCoreInfo": {
    "Core": "A Cube Sugar 3.0"
  },
  "BakaConfigInfo": {
    "BakaVer": "BakaVer [V.3.222]",
    "Language": "zh_CN",
    "CloseAfterLaunch": false,
    "AutoFix": true,
    "BMCLAPI": false,
    "BMCLAPIMirror": 0,
    "DisableMavenMirror": false,
    "ThreadMode": 4,
    "AllowNetworkRelay": true,
    "AutoJava": true,
    "JavaPath": "C:\\Users\\{UserName}\\AppData\\Roaming\\.minecraft\\runtime\\java\\java-runtime-beta\\windows-x64\\java-runtime-beta\\bin\\javaw.exe",
    "AutoMemory": true,
    "Memory": "4096",
    "JavaGC": "G1GC",
    "Background": "{Default}",
    "TemaName": null,
    "TemaColor": "Blue",
    "NightMode": false,
    "CustomWindowSize": true,
    "WindowWidth": 1036,
    "WindowHeight": 584.666666666667,
    "BackgroundParallax": false,
    "BackgroundParallaxMode": 0,
    "LiveBackground": false,
    "Acrylic": false,
    "AcrylicType": 1,
    "AcrylicManual": false,
    "AcrylicOpacity": 0,
    "FrameRate": 60,
    "StandardDisplayMode": true,
    "StandardSwitchCoreMode": false,
    "ShowOldCoreTile": true,
    "MusicStatus": true,
    "Volume": 0,
    "LostFocusMusicBehavior": false,
    "AutoMusicDetection": true,
    "ForceExit": true,
    "Debug": false,
    "HomeScrollValue": 0,
    "CellularNetwork": false,
    "MCWidth": 854,
    "MCHeight": 480,
    "AllowGeoLocation": true,
    "MediaElementSafeMode": false
  }
}